    As mentioned above it depends greatly on many factors......

    Lithium batteries hold a charge longer than any other kind of battery on the market, maintaining 90% of its charge over approx. 10 years - so you might as well buy a few of them, just in case - especially if you are shooting digital.
    There are many ways you can drag that battery out as long as possible, ie. turn off the af-assist light, minimize use of popup flash, avoid long exposures, use center weighted metering over 3D-matrix metering, and on digital cameras minimize using the LCD for previewing.

    But yeah, it never hurts to have 2-3 spare batteries.
